Flutter vs Kotlin: Which One Should You Choose?

Kathleen Edwards
2 replies

Replies

My Phung
How about react native with expo? Assuming this is mobile
Christopher Black
Choosing between Flutter and Kotlin for your next project can be a daunting task as both have their own unique strengths and advantages. Flutter, developed by Google, is an open-source user interface software development kit that allows you to create natively compiled apps for mobile, web, and desktop from a single code base. It is known for its fast development cycles, expressive and flexible user interface, and extensive collection of widgets. On the other hand, Kotlin, supported by JetBrains, is a statically typed programming language for modern multi-platform applications. It gained popularity due to its simplicity, security and compatibility with Java. Kotlin is also the language of choice for Android development, making it a strong contender for mobile app projects. When choosing between them, consider the specific needs of your project: Cross-platform development. If your goal is to develop Android and iOS apps with a single codebase, Flutter may be the best choice. It enables fast development and offers a rich set of pre-designed widgets. Own development for Android. If you're focused primarily on Android development and value seamless integration with the Android ecosystem, Kotlin will likely be right for you. To get more information about Flutter development and learn about the leading companies specializing in this platform, check out this informative article: https://www.cogniteq.com/blog/top-flutter-app-development-companies. It provides a detailed overview of the leading firms that can help you leverage the power of Flutter for your project. Ultimately, the best choice depends on your specific requirements, development resources, and long-term goals. Both Flutter and Kotlin have strong community support and extensive resources to help you succeed.